Output 0458109ac8eb84f1af59f25ec76d6fffd2b18239c58922e2d8ba26b517ea5c9e:72

value
221449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166423063ad5ae8e2bf7b0933a656be0be3cdea8 OP_EQUAL
address
M9wZ4H6JmcDMU2Cpu5hA9kwGgxgbXAbLu6
transaction
0458109ac8eb84f1af59f25ec76d6fffd2b18239c58922e2d8ba26b517ea5c9e
spent
false